21、微处理器系统:从16位到64位及内存技术解析

微处理器系统:从16位到64位及内存技术解析

1. 条件码寄存器标志位解析

在微处理器的运算中,条件码寄存器的标志位起着关键作用,它们能反映运算结果的各种状态。
- 溢出标志(V) :在进行二进制补码算术运算时,V输出位置出现1表示发生了溢出情况;当V等于0时,则表示未发生溢出。
- 零标志(Z) :寄存器的Z输出位置用于指示算术运算的结果是否为零。若Z等于0,结果为零;若Z等于1,结果不为零。
- 负标志(N) :条件码寄存器的N位表示算术运算后第7位的状态。当第7位为1时,N等于1,代表二进制补码运算结果为负;当N等于0时,第7位为0,结果为正。
- 中断禁止标志(I) :当条件码输出的I位等于1时,微处理器(MPU)无法响应外部源的中断请求;当I等于0时,允许中断发生。
- 半进位标志(H) :CCR输出的H位用于在加法、带进位加法或累加器加法操作中指示半进位情况。当执行指令时H等于1,表示从第3位到第4位有进位;当H等于0时,表示第3位没有产生进位。
- 第6和第7位 :CC寄存器输出的第6和第7位在正常操作中不是特定的指示位,在常规操作中它们保持为1状态。

2. 16位微处理器

20世纪80年代初,为了提高产品的数据处理和寻址能力,微处理器制造商推出了一系列能一次处理16位数据的新设备,催生了新一代个人计算机。以下是几种常见的16位微处理器:
| 微处理器型号 | 数据总线

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值